Wagstaff + Rogers Architects Designer of custom homes and custom commercial space in Northern California

Our methodology infuses traditional craftsmanship with a passion for new technologies, materials and a strong philosophy about art in architecture. The range of our work includes significant high-end new residential and remodels as well as mixed use, institutional, historic rehabilitation, and commercial architecture, throughout Marin County and the San Francisco Bay area. Green design is an integ

ral part of our design process that increases the finish quality and value of the project along with the benefits to the environment. More than just the design, the relationships we build with our clients, contractors, consultants and community are key.

Marin’s updated wildfire regulations, including the new ban on wood exteriors in high risk zones, will significantly impact both remodels in the future and new construction after January 1, 2026. Classes start January 13, 2026 and we are accepting applications now!

North Bay Construction Corps - Class of Marin addresses the high demand for construction workers in our community. This program enables students to explore a variety of construction-related careers and prepares adults for positions with local Marin Builders Association firms at the end of each class cycle.
